Product Manager, Audience Development

Farm Journal is searching for a Product Manager to join our Audience Development team!

This person will serve as a subject matter expert on the marketing automation system and expertly translate strategic business objectives into technical orchestration. They will also be responsible for optimizing the go-to-market campaign strategy with cross-functional marketing teams, and key stakeholders.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
These duties include, but are not limited to, the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Develop campaign frameworks and work hand in hand with the team responsible for daily execution.
  • Drive improvement of program effectiveness through advanced audience segmentation, journey mapping, A/B testing, and deliverability for client campaigns both internal and external.
  • Partner across marketing technology internal team to amplify the effectiveness of data integrity management and new technology integrations.
  • Continuously monitor and optimize campaigns and programs.
  • Stay on top of automation best practices to stay ahead of industry trends related to digital demand generation and multi-channel marketing.
  • Build and deploy programs to maintain database organization and integrity.
  • Stay current with marketing automation best practices, industry standards and compliance.
  • Lead development of the product strategy and roadmap, collaborating with key stakeholders.
  • Understand how to connect market needs (requirements) with the product development requirements and prioritize accordingly with stakeholder input (key stakeholders: data intelligence, audience development, content services, digital operations, and editorial).
  • Work with external third parties to assess partnerships and licensing opportunities.
  • Run beta and pilot programs with early-stage products and samples.
  • Be an expert with respect to the competition.
  • Act as a leader within the company.

Skills/Professional Experience
These qualifications include, but are not limited to, the following:

  • Expertise in Marketo including specific technical or industry knowledge.
  • Superior project management and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to maintain a keen attention to detail, multitask and work well under pressure.
  • Natural tendency to be curious, positive, and creative.
  • Team player who collaborates well with others.
